COM基础2

COM把一个组件的功能分割到多个接口里,每一个接口都把一个小的、准确的功能集展现出来。(通过多个VTable实现)

使用组件的模块可以直接与所需的功能模块(功能集)打交道。

 

加入对marshaling的支持,从而能可以cross-thread, cross-process, cross-machine environments使用组件

 

com使用注册表来存储组件信息

 

组件必须在一个windows进程内执行,也就说组件宿主必须是DLL 或 EXE

posted on 2014-06-12 21:34  aoun  阅读(161)  评论(0编辑  收藏  举报